Don't even think about pulling out a driver , Well not until you can see a flag and then be sure your drive does'nt run through the fairway because the rough is long and grabby. Great track , love the way some of tee boxs are shielded by trees and not exposing you to rest of the course, Now having said that . This course is tough good club selection is must, you don't want to be short or long because these greens will eat you up. My tip for anyone playing CrossCreek is " leave the driver at home and carry another wedge in its place"

At 25.00 bucks for twlight the General is a "steal". The greens are in great condition, rolling true and not pitted with divots. It's a comfort to know I can nail a long par 3 with a wood and not rely on a long iron. If your looking for a track that is well maintained where it counts, but a little rough in terms of scenery then the General is a must play.......
